Output 03e84b849d814c9651c9f38dcde215db6718f58d3f7c40b5617dbccbf6cac2a8:0

value
539850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577665e1c6c4e2ccbed9f5e8fe037b80ee642867 OP_EQUAL
address
39fUYfjUNHtxYc2ebp54TKie9R9AgEb5Di
transaction
03e84b849d814c9651c9f38dcde215db6718f58d3f7c40b5617dbccbf6cac2a8
spent
true